Opa João, tudo certo?
Uma possível solução para esse caso é utilizar o Spring para fazer as instâncias, dessa forma, você pode utilizar essas instâncias dentro da classe sem precisar se preocupar em criar manualmente os objetos.
Todavia, vale ressaltar que como você postou sua pergunta há algum tempo é possível que a constante evolução da tecnologia impacte na resolução da sua dúvida. Sendo assim, caso queira se aprofundar neste tema e com conteúdos atualizados, recomendo o material abaixo:
Espero ter ajudado.
Abraços e bons estudos!